Goessel Mayor Ben Schmidt Resigns During City Meeting

GOESSEL, Kan. — Goessel Mayor Ben Schmidt resigned on July 17 during the City Council meeting, effective immediately. In his letter of resignation, Schmidt cited family commitments in part for his decision. He also noted a number of frustrations, in particular a recent survey that... Read More.
